Bob Bond is a Houston estate planning attorney and Certified Public Accountant. His practice is devoted to estate planning, probate and related legal documents. He grew up in Dallas and graduated from Southern Methodist University with a B.A. in Economics. He served in the U.S. Army as an Infantry Officer. Lieutenant Colonel Bond retired after 20 years of distinguished service that included positions as Executive Officer for a 550-man Armor Battalion, the Training Officer for the 18,000 soldiers of the 2nd Infantry Division in Korea, and the Inspector General for the Montana National Guard.
During his military career, he earned a Masters Degree in Accounting and passed the CPA Examination. After his retirement, he returned to Texas to go to law school and put down roots. At St. Mary’s Law School in San Antonio, he was a member of Phi Delta Phi (the national honor society for law students), the Board of Advocates, he participated in numerous mock trials, and was selected for Who’s Who Among American Law Students. Immediately after law school, he worked for Arthur Andersen & Company where he assisted clients with personal financial planning and tax planning. He then worked for Smith-Moore & Associates, where he worked in the area of estate planning and asset protection. Mr. Bond is a member in good standing of the State Bar of Texas and the College of the State Bar (an organization for attorneys who have maintained a high degree of continuing professional education).

Likewise, seniors have no idea that they have a need for Medicaid estate planning. The Texas Health and Human Services Commission are not allowed to give legal and financial advice with regards to qualification. Many spend-down needlessly because they don’t understand the rules.
